## ChipLine Reader v5.4 — key rotation

Hey support folks — quick note so you're not surprised by firmware-update questions this weekend. We rotated the signing credential for the ChipLine timing-chip readers ahead of the Marrow Bay Marathon. Readers on firmware 5.2 or older will refuse the new updates until staff re-enroll the trust bundle from the kiosk menu (Settings > Security > Refresh). If a race director calls about "update rejected" errors, that's why. For reference, the new signing key is below.

rollout seal: bky4_x7Gc

Action item: The Relayn deploy-status bot silently dropped updates when the pipeline API paginated results, so responders believed a rollback had completed when it had not. We will add pagination handling, a staleness banner, and an integration test. Until merged, verify deploy state directly in the pipeline console, documented at the page below.

runbook for kahop-kajop: https://rundeck.ordinio.test/display/secrets/pipeline/issue/pages/repo/browse/e5732776e07d1285107e5aeb

- [ ] Step 7: Archive cold storage buckets (Glacierline tier). Confirm both ceremony witnesses are present, verify bucket manifests match the Oxbow ledger, then seal the archive key shares. Plugin authors may observe but not handle shares. Once sealed, the archive index itself is encrypted and can only be reopened with the passphrase below.

vault phrase of badup-hahig = tamael-aldael-kelmir-istael-fenok-istwyn-tamius-jorath-oliion